I am so discussed with this company. I asked for a defement back in November for December, so that I could used the money to take care of some hurricane damage to my car. Paymnts are normally drafted from my savings. When I spoke to them they said fine, but we have to secure a payment for January. So I agreed and gave them my checking information. Come December the idiots took a payment out of my savings account for December. I called and was furious that they did what they did. After speaking with the accounts manager who was so rude and was talking over me and threaten to hang the phone up on me because I wouldn't let him speak. I got hold of the HR director (Margaret Fogarty) who apolgized and stated that she would get to the bottom of the situation and find out what is what. So I get a call telling me that there was a form mailed to me authorizing the deferment that was never turned in. I told her that I never recieved the form and no one mentioned I had to do this procedure and had I known that the form would of been returned immediatly. So I cancelled the deferment. And cancelled eft drafting from my account.

Later in December, it turned out that I would still need the deferment. So I called and asked and they set it up again at this time they mentioned that the form had to be signed and faxed back to a Kathleen. I recieved the form and faxed it to them several times to make sure it was done, I even called at the beginning of January to make sure that all drafting was cancelled and the deferment was set up. I had recieved a confirmation verbally along with a confirmation number. Turns out that on Jan 18th my checking was drafted for a pmt. I was pissed, my account had a negative balance with alot of NSF fees. I am so angry that i was planning to visit personally to find out what the hell is the damn problem. Not only did I cancel EFT completly, they took upon themselves to draft my checking which I never authorize a payment.in the past it had always been my savings they depleted. So I called Centrix as soon as I found out. I spoke with a rep then the Reasearch manager Judy. She stated everything had been cancelled far as my eft drafting but I never cancelled the checking payment done back in Novemeber. My blood pressure hit the ceiling... They gave me some BS excuse that it had been drafted because I had given them a check by phone in November and that transaction was never cancelled. I told them we cancelled all that when the first deferment didn't go through; how stupid can they be? So she told me to call back the next day because accounting was closed for the day.
